The Internship and Research Immersion in Singapore (IRIS)@NUS is organised by NUS Graduate School. This fully funded, two-month programme welcomes exceptional undergraduate and master’s students from ALL fields across ASEAN and around the world. It offers an immersive research experience and a unique glimpse into graduate studies at one of the top universities in the world.
Students will be mentored by NUS’ dedicated faculty upon joining their labs or research groups. Additionally, students will have the opportunity to contribute to ongoing projects, work in world-class facilities, and gain hands-on experience in cutting-edge research. A prestigious opening ceremony and poster sessions will also enable students to network with peers and NUS scholars, enhancing their communication skills and fostering a community that supports their potential PhD journey.
Beyond research, the programme features enriching experiences such as city tours, industry visits, and interactive workshops, offering deeper insights into Singapore and NUS’ dynamic culture and innovative ecosystem.
Through IRIS@NUS, students will explore and tackle global challenges, gain tangible experience in graduate-level research, and unlock exciting possibilities for scientific research in their future careers.
Two months of intensive research experience with exposure to state-of-the-art research and facilities at NUS.
Close mentorship and guidance from NUS faculty members throughout the internship. Project presentations, Interactive workshops and hands-on practice. A certificate of completion issued by NUS Graduate School at the end of the programme.
SGD 1,200 stipend per month.* SGD 600 travel allowance. Complimentary on-campus accommodation.
Explore Singapore and the NUS campus, and experience what it’s like to live and study here in the future.
*T&C applies.
The inaugural IRIS@NUS programme will commence in June 2025. Application period is now open* | |||
---|---|---|---|
Programme Duration | June - July 2025 | ||
Application Deadline | 28 February 2025 | ||
First-Round Results Release | Mid-March 2025 Shortlisted candidates will be interviewed by their assigned faculty mentors. | ||
Final List Announcement | End of March 2025 |
*There will be three IRIS@NUS intakes in AY2025/2026. If you are interested in participating outside the June – July period, please specify your preferred times in the application portal.
Note that this is subject to the faculty mentors’ and research projects’ availabilities.
Academic Excellence
Undergraduates and first-year master’s students with outstanding academic records.
Passion
Candidates with a genuine interest in academic research.
Diversity
Priority will be given to ASEAN and less represented countries.
At the Internship and Research Immersion in Singapore (IRIS) @NUS programme, students will participate in research across various colleges, faculties, and schools within NUS, contributing to innovative and impactful projects.
The allocation of mentors will be finalised following the first round of selection in mid-March. Students will be matched with mentors based on their expressed research interests and the availability of faculty’s ongoing work.
